Dancewear and Costume Shop


At 5, 000 square feet, Shelly's Dancewear feels like the wardrobe department for an MGM musical. Dripping from racks are colorful leotards, tights, tutus, sequined gloves, ballet slippers, hats, canes, and everything else you'd need for a rousing dance number. In addition, Shelly's carries exercise-, skate-, and activewear, as well as costumes (witches, bunnies), year-round. There's a well-stocked sale section, and sidewalk sales take place every few months.
